Types of Advanced Technology Used in Tax Consultancy

When discussing the overview of tax consultancy services that utilize advanced technology, it's essential to understand the various technological tools and systems that are transforming the landscape. Here's a breakdown of some of the most impactful technologies currently in use:

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ning

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ning (ML) are rapidly becoming core components in tax consultancy services. These technologies can help automate complex calculations, reduce human error, and provide predictive insights into tax obligations.

  • Automation of Routine Processes: AI can handle repetitive tasks such as data entry, allowing consultants to focus on strategic decisions.

  • Predictive Analytics: Machine learning algorithms analyze historical data to forecast future tax liabilities.

Cloud Computing

Cloud computing offers significant advantages in data storage and management, allowing tax consultants to access information anytime and from anywhere. This is particularly beneficial in a client-centric industry like tax consultancy.

  • Scalability: Firms can easily adjust their storage and computing resources based on demand.

  • Collaboration: Cloud platforms enable seamless communication and collaboration between tax professionals and clients.

Data Analytics and Big Data

Data analytics tools allow tax consultants to derive actionable insights from vast amounts of financial data. By utilizing big data technologies, firms can enhance compliance and offer personalized services.

  • Risk Assessment: Analyzing extensive data sets helps identify compliance risks and opportunities for optimization.

  • Tailored Solutions: Firms can create custom strategies for clients based on data-driven insights.

Blockchain Technology

Blockchain is making waves in the financial industry, including tax consultancy. It provides a secure, transparent way to record transactions, which can be invaluable for compliance and audit purposes.

  • Integrity of Data: Transactions recorded on a blockchain are immutable, ensuring accuracy in reporting.

  • Streamlined Audits: Blockchain can expedite the audit process by providing quick access to secured records.

Challenges in Implementing Advanced Technology in Tax Consultancy

While the overview of tax consultancy services that utilize advanced technology reveals numerous benefits, it is also essential to address the challenges that firms face in implementing these technologies. Understanding these barriers can help consultants navigate the transition more effectively.

Data Security and Privacy Concerns

As tax consultancy firms increasingly rely on technology, safeguarding sensitive client information becomes paramount. The potential for data breaches poses significant risks.

  • Cybersecurity Threats: Tax services handling large volumes of personal financial data are prime targets for cyber attacks.

  • Compliance with Regulations: Firms must ensure they are compliant with data protection regulations, such as GDPR in Europe or CCPA in California, which adds to operational complexity.

Adoption Resistance by Traditional Firms

Many established tax consultancy firms may exhibit reluctance to embrace new technologies due to concern over costs or disruption of existing workflows.

  • Cultural Resistance: Traditional practices can be deeply ingrained within organizations, making change challenging.

  • Training and Skill Gaps: Staff members may require extensive training to adapt to new systems, which can be a time-consuming and costly endeavor.

Regulatory Compliance Issues

Tax regulations are constantly evolving, and with the introduction of advanced technologies, there may be gaps in understanding how these regulations apply to new tools.

  • Keeping Up with Changes: Rapidly changing tax laws necessitate ongoing education and adaptation, which can strain resources.

  • Complexity of Compliance: Integrating technology while ensuring full compliance with tax laws adds another layer of complexity to operations.

Cost of Implementation

Investing in advanced technology can require significant upfront costs, which may deter some firms from making the leap.

  • Infrastructure Costs: Modern technologies often necessitate upgraded IT infrastructure, which can be financially burdensome.

  • Ongoing Maintenance: Continuous updates and maintenance of systems require ongoing investment and manpower.
